+1. OVERVIEW
+
+The file iwlwifi-5000-1.ucode provided in this package must be
+present on your system in order for the Intel Wireless WiFi Link
+5000AGN driver for Linux (iwlwifi-5000) to operate on your system.
+
+The "-1" in the filename reflects an interface/architecture version number.
+It will change only when changes in new uCode releases make the new uCode
+incompatible with earlier drivers.
+
+On adapter initialization, and at varying times during the uptime of
+the adapter, the microcode is loaded into the memory on the network
+adapter. The microcode provides the low level MAC features including
+radio control and high precision timing events (backoff, transmit,
+etc.) while also providing varying levels of packet filtering which can
+be used to keep the host from having to handle packets that are not of
+interest given the current operating mode of the device.

+2. INSTALLATION
+
+The iwl5000 driver will look for the file iwlwifi-5000-1.ucode using the
+kernel's firmware_loader infrastructure. In order to function
+correctly, you need to have this support enabled in your kernel. When
+you configure the kernel, you can find this option in the following
+location:
+
+ Device Drivers ->
+ Generic Driver Options ->
+ Hotplug firmware loading support
+
+
+You can determine if your kernel currently has firmware loader support
+by looking for the CONFIG_FW_LOADER definition on your kernel's
+.config.
+
+In addition to having the firmware_loader support in your kernel, you
+must also have a working hotplug and udev infrastructure configured.
+The steps for installing and configuring hotplug and udev are very
+distribution specific.
+
+Once you have the firmware loader in place (or if you aren't sure and
+you just want to try things to see if it works), you need to install
+the microcode file into the appropriate location.
+
+Where that appropriate location is depends (again) on your system
+distribution. You can typically find this location by looking in the
+hotplug configuration file for your distro:
+
+ % grep \"^FIRMWARE_DIR\" /etc/hotplug/firmware.agent
+
+This should give you output like:
+
+ FIRMWARE_DIR=/lib/firmware
+
+If it lists more than one directory, you only need to put the
+microcode in one of them. In the above example, installation is
+simply:
+
+ % cp iwlwifi-5000-3x3-1.ucode /lib/firmware
+
+You can now load the driver (see the INSTALL and README.iwlwifi provided with
+the iwlwifi package for information on building and using that driver.)
